Note to the Listener(s)

Since May of 2020 I have been a frequent guest on the David Feldman Show. The songs on this page are just some of the thirty or more that I have written and recorded for the show. I produce these in my office at home and so they aren't what I would call studio quality. But I have had so many requests from Feldman listeners that I have decided to post them here, just as they are. With the exception of two, that feature Rosana Eckert, all the parts (vocal and instrumental) are done by me. Some attempts are better than others and I think have gotten better lately. The No Evil Blues

No Evil Foods presented themselves as a progressive company, but when their workers tried to organize they showed their true colors. The National Labor Review Board filed a complaint against the company in 2020.

Ain't No Chairs #1

Wrote this when organizers were trying to unionize the Bessemer, Alabama plant. Amazon fulfillment centers
are brutal places to work. Turns out they don't have chairs.
Workers sometimes walk 16 miles a day.

Ain't No Chairs #2
Thought the song needed a bit more edge. I like the groove on this one. I heard from an organizer that they played this at some rallies in Bessemer. Two votes have failed but the work continues. We stand in solidarity with those in the Amazon union.
